Think again. The ride on a bus or subway in Tokyo costs $3.25. Grab a newspaper and a cup of coffee on the way and the total comes to $11.70. That's more than anywhere else in the world--24% more than what those same things cost in New York, even.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Tokyo is the world's most expensive city, according to Mercer's 2009 Worldwide Cost of Living survey released today, with the cost of living up 13.1% from 2008; the city ranked at No. 2 in 2008's survey. Japan's capital is followed by Osaka and Moscow, which held the top spot in last year's rankings. Geneva comes in fourth.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The significant changes from last year are due to massive swings in exchange rates, with many currencies at their weakest in years against the U.S. dollar, during the March 2009 survey period. Because of this, New York moved up 14 spaces to No. 8 from No. 22. London dropped to No. 16 from No. 3 as the pound dropped as low as 1.37 against the U.S. dollar during the study period. Six months earlier, one pound was worth $1.86.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"Changes in exchange rate tend to be one of the major drivers, I would argue the major driver, in cost of living," says Rebecca Powers, a principal consultant at Mercer. Even with the U.S. dollar weakening over the past four months--it's now worth $1.65--due in part to the Obama administration's stimulus package, the cost of living in London, when measured against the value of the U.S. dollar, is significantly lower than it was a year ago, when the pound was worth more than $2.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Other notable jumps from last year's ranking to this year's are Dubai, which moved to No. 20 from No. 52, and Caracas, which moved to No. 15 from No. 89. Both climbed so quickly because the local currencies are pegged to the greenback; the more the dollar's value increased, so did the cost of living in those places (but Caracas also has a high rate of inflation, pushing up prices for basic goods).&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;All U.S. cities included in the ranking also experienced a rise, including Los Angeles, up 32 places, and Washington, D.C., up 41 places.&lt;br /&gt;Behind the Numbers&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;To generate its ranking of the world's most expensive cities, Mercer, an international consulting firm, looked at more than 200 cities across six continents, examining the cost of over 200 items in each location, including housing, food, clothing, transport, household goods and entertainment to calculate an overall cost of living. The survey is used to help multinational companies determine compensation packages for employees living abroad. Mercer uses New York as the base city for the index and scores the cost of living there at 100 points. Cities scoring higher are more expensive; lower than 100, and they're cheaper. All cities included in the ranking are in comparison to New York, and currency is measured against the U.S. dollar.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"Since we're polling those places in a local environment, we're getting costs in a local currency," Powers says. "When the currencies fluctuate, that has a significant affect on costs." Powers says these cost fluctuations are making multinational companies reassess the need for expansion abroad.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"Companies have been much more guarded about their investments," she says. "While you can still argue that there is interest in emerging markets, the general pattern of money flowing into the same markets was interrupted when companies started looking at their money."&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Johannesburg, South Africa (No. 143) bottoms out the complete list of cities with a score of 49.6. Also at the tail end are Monterrey, Mexico (No. 142), and Asuncion, Paraguay (No. 141).&lt;br /&gt;Tokyo Steady, Shaky Everywhere Else&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The main constant in these rankings, since Mercer's first set was released in 1994, is Tokyo's place at or close to the top. Osaka has only fallen outside the top 10, once, when it slipped to the No. 11 spot last year. While the value of the yen is strong against the dollar, Japan--and Tokyo in particular--has always featured prominently due to the high cost of international goods, says Mercer senior researcher Nathalie Constantin-Metral. One can count on Japan being expensive in good times and bad alike for the yen.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;But there's no telling what will happen in a place like Moscow--which zoomed up to the top spot last year, and fell out of it this year. It will all depend, says Constantin-Metral, on the performance of Russia's currency. The ruble had been on a long, steady climb against the greenback as of March 2008; but it bottomed out at the beginning of March 2009. It's been on a recovery trajectory ever since, but still has a long way to go. Either way, the rankings make clear that the more the ruble slips, the less expensive a city Moscow becomes.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;American cities, then, have more in common with a place like Moscow than anywhere in Japan. The more the dollar--and prices--move, the more or less expensive U.S. cities get, which means it's all up in the air as to what will happen over the year ahead. Tokyo and Osaka may be expensive, but at least everyone knows it for certain. Just about everywhere else, it seems, nobody knows for sure what the cost of living is like until the year is already in the rear-view mirror.&lt;br /&gt;World's Top Five Most Expensive Cities To Live&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;1. The working group recommends purifying tap water with a commercial filter, however.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Both reports were released at a congressional subcommittee Wednesday morning.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Bottled water — an industry worth about $16 billion in sales last year — has been suffering lately as colleges, communities and some governments take measures to limit or ban its consumption. As employers, they are motivated by cost savings and environmental concern because the bottles often are not recycled.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Bottled water sales were growing by double-digit percentages for years and were helping buoy the U.S. beverage industry overall. But they were flat last year, according to trade publication Beverage Digest.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Beverage Digest editor John Sicher said some consumers are turning on the tap during the recession simply because it's cheaper.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;From 1997 to 2007, the amount of bottled water consumed per person in the U.S. more than doubled, from 13.4 gallons to 29.3 gallons, the GAO report said.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The issue before a subcommittee of the Energy and Commerce Committee was less about waste and water quality concerns and more about the mechanics of regulating bottled water.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;As a food product, bottled water is regulated by the Food and Drug Administration and required to show nutrition information and ingredients on its labels. Municipal water is under the control of the Environmental Protection Agency.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The two agencies have similar standards for water quality, but the FDA has less authority to enforce them, the GAO said, and the environmental agency requires much more testing.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Subcommittee chairman Rep. Bart Stupak, D-Mich., said the subcommittee was requesting information Wednesday from a dozen bottled water companies on their water sources, treatment methods and two years' results of contaminant testing. The good news, however, is that out of the total cases, 374 have fully recovered.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Health Secretary Francisco Duque III said that based on the autopsy report, the viral infection was not the primary cause of the death, but rather “congestive heart failure secondary to acute myocardial infarction aggravated by severe pneumonia – either bacterial, viral or both.”&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;“This one is a very interesting case. It embodies several high-risk and pre-disposing factors that accelerated the death (of the patient). It is in line with what we have been saying for several weeks, that complicated cases will be encountered,” Duque noted at a press conference.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Aside from congestive heart disease, the patient was found to have tuberculosis, enlarged liver, kidney and spleen, tumor in the uterus and tyromegaly or goiter.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The patient was not even in the DOH’s records of suspected and confirmed A(H1N1) cases and had no history of travel to countries that have the virus.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;According to Duque, the patient came home from work with a cough last June 17 and developed fever, cold and chills the following day so she did not report for work.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;On June 19, the patient was no longer able to take her breakfast and suddenly experienced difficulty in breathing. She died even before the doctor called by her family arrived.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The next day, the brother notified Duque about the incident and throat swab samples were collected from the patient.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The specimens tested positive for A(H1N1).&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;“Given the available information, we cannot conclude that the death is due to A(H1N1). But in other countries which have reported A(H1N1) deaths, a majority have pre-existing medical conditions. We condole with the family of the patient as we mourn her untimely death,” Duque, who was a friend of the patient’s brother, said.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;He assured the public that the patient no longer poses a threat to those who might attend her wake because the virus dies when the host-body perishes.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The DOH had advised the household contacts of the patients to observe self-quarantine while it is checking with others who could have come in close contact with her.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Duque said the husband had manifested symptoms ahead of the patient but he tested negative for the virus when examined. The patient’s son, mother, sister and brother have not developed flu-like symptoms.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;With this development, the health secretary said that the DOH will be “more aggressive in targeting segments of patients with high vulnerability to fatal flu complications and who should be the ones to receive the most care and attention by healthcare professionals.”&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Malacañang immediately stepped into the picture and urged the public not to panic.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Deputy presidential spokeswoman Lorelei Fajardo said the victim was considered a “high-risk” case and health authorities still consider her infection as mild.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;“I think our DOH officials are on the right track by giving more attention to the high-risk patients,” Fajardo said.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;“There’s nothing to be alarmed about.
